VALENTINE'S CARD - FRONT VIEW
I made this pretty accordion-fold card tonight for The Pink Stamper's Blog Hop (which started last night), and I thought I'd share it with you, along with the instructions:
1. Cut a 5 1/2" x 12" piece of plain cardstock (I used white).
2. With a score-pal or a scorer of some type, score at 1", 2", 4", 6" and 9". The 9" piece is the top.
3. Fold top down, next piece up, alternating (see picture).
4. Cover the folded areas with decorative paper.
5. To make the little pocket for the message, cut a plain piece of cardstock 2 3/4" x 5 3/4".
6. Fold both long sides and one short side in 1/4" and glue on the folded areas. Place piece on second space from the top with the opening facing the right.
7. Cut another piece of plain card stock small enough to fit inside this pocket - about 2 1/4"x 5 1/2" and attach a small tab or ribbon (I used a pink ribbon) for a pulley. Insert this with your message inside the pocket you have made.
8. Decorate the folds with some hearts and other embellishments so they stick out a little over the top of each fold. Enjoy!!
